Berlin imposes highest security level amid Zelenskyy’s visit — Bild

Berlin has introduced security level “0,” the highest possible, due to the visit of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y. This level indicates that authorities consider the risk of attacks or assassination attempts to be high, Bild reported.

According to the outlet, Zelenskyy’s visit to Germany could prove “decisive.” A peace summit involving U.S. representatives and the Ukrainian delegation is expected to take place in the German capital. Bild warned Berlin residents to avoid the government district on Monday, as the area will be sealed off. Traffic disruptions and suspensions of urban rail services are expected.

Journalists recalled that during Zelenskyy’s previous visit to Berlin in August, emergency security measures were also implemented. At that time, snipers were deployed on buildings and helicopters, bomb-sniffing dogs were used, police boats patrolled the river, and roads throughout the government and parliamentary quarters were closed.

Zelenskyy has already arrived in Berlin, along with U.S. representatives Steve Witkoff and Jared Kushner. The Ukrainian president said preparations for meetings are underway and noted that there are “many important details” to be addressed.

“The key is that all steps we agree on with our partners work in practice to ensure guaranteed security. Only reliable guarantees can secure peace. We expect our partners to continue constructive cooperation,” Zelenskyy said.

Russia, meanwhile, continues to insist on the withdrawal of Ukrainian forces from the entire Donbas region as a condition for a ceasefire. This demand was included in the U.S. peace plan. According to media reports, Ukraine has submitted its own version of the plan to Washington, which предусматриes maintaining Ukrainian control over all its territories. The New York Times noted that such a proposal is almost certain to be unacceptable to Moscow.
